2011-10-18 137 views
-1

我正在爲我的Web應用程序(PHP)創建用戶間圖像共享功能,這意味着所有用戶都可以將他們的圖像上載到我的服務器。 那麼, 我的第一個假設是我需要一個專用的服務器來「我的圖片共享」功能。 問題是,如果服務器會得到很多請求 - 瓶頸將被創建。圖像共享功能

  • 我學到了緩存(memcached的,清漆,魷魚......) 你認爲這些技術之一,是適合我?

  • 什麼是最適合我的理想建築?我認爲在某一點上只有一臺服務器是不夠的。 所以我想我會需要服務器集羣(主從)。對?

如果你能給我一些關於正確的技術&體系結構的方向,我將非常高興。

回答

1

一切都取決於你將有多大的流量。你能估計它嗎? Cashinig解決方案對於samall圖像來說不錯。我有一些圖像共享/投票網站和相當大的流量(每月12毫升全圖像下載)的經驗。